Fold pre-flop in position with K8s after it's been folded to you ?
And then be passive all the way after no one shows strength ?

I'm no expert but isn't that weak ?

With 3 opponents atleast one person called ahead of you if the blinds stayed in. K8 doesn't play very well multi way, what are you hoping to hit, your K, or your 8? fold it or raise as a bluff/blind steal if the blinds are high in a S&Go.

If if was checked to me again on the turn and another flush card didn't fall I might bluff at it. If another flush card fell on the turn I would check/fold. Flushes oftne get checked on the flop as they are so obvious.

All of which still depends on reads, chip stacks, my image and if this is a cash game or tournament.
